The cataract seminar earlier today was given by one of our board certified cataract surgeons, Dr Zweibel, discussing the details of cataracts as well as cataract surgery. Our eye physicians and surgeons, Dr. Jeff Martin, Dr. Larry Zweibel, Dr Sidney Martin and Dr. John Mauro,will be conducting  monthly seminars to afford  patients better education in their decision to have cataract surgery.  Cataract surgery is an outpatient procedure that is conducted under IV and the use of topical numbing eye drops and therefore do not use needles around the eyes, stitches, or even an eye patch following surgery.  Patients then have the opportunity to choose a standard IOL or upgrade to a premium implant that reduces or eliminates the need for glasses at all distances.  These implants are called Crystalens, Restor, and Tecnis Multifocal.
